Description
This book affords researchers and educators with essential tools for examining U.S. classrooms in response to the present national reform agendas' stress on making rigorous content and high expectations accessible to all students. Improving the achievement in U.S. schools, important for both social and economic stability, will require that instruction be responsive to our nation's increasingly diverse student population. This volume accordingly provides examples of recently developed classroom observation instruments based on research of effective teaching practices for culturally and linguistically diverse students. Each chapter will assist educators in their endeavors to improve U.S. schools.
